Tonic Design: iconic furniture
Balancing form and function, Tonic Design’s bold yet minimalist bedside tables are what sweet dreams are made of.
Here are our top picks from the award-winning design studio:
Cannes Pedestal
Finely detailed and finished in custom high gloss colours, the Cannes Pedestal adds a dose of Deco-inspired drama to bedroom interiors. The Cannes Pedestal pairs beautifully with the Nova Bed in natural oak and a good paperback novel.
Paris Pedestal
Equal parts seductive and sensible, the Paris pedestal turns bedside storage into an affair to remember. This spacious option is available in oak and American walnut veneer for a timeless touch.
Michael Pedestal
A decidedly handsome bedside table available in oil-finished oak or satin-lacquered American walnut veneer, the Michael Pedestal features one or two drawers with recessed grip handles and sufficient space to keep all your bedside bric-à-brac at bay. Add a Laguna Table Lamp from Artemide to complete the look.
Marsi Pedestal
Give your bedroom an au naturel upgrade with the Marsi Pedestal. A chic marble inlay top and powder-coated mild-steel base make the Marsi Pedestal an elegant and understated choice.
A stalwart of South African design, Tonic Design is well-known for its unorthodox use of materials, its emphasis on technical precision and a return to traditional techniques and craftsmanship that makes their work contemporary, collectable future classics.
With showrooms in Johannesburg and Cape Town, the interior-architectural studio specialises in the design of iconic furniture and interiors that are undeniably current, enduringly classic and instantly liveable.
